    📦 Breathing Practice (Box Breathing):

    Breathe in for 4 → Hold for 4 → Exhale for 4 → Hold for 4. Repeat for 3–5 minutes.

    🚶‍♂️ Simple Walks:

    Walking is underrated. It’s free, accessible, and wildly effective for processing emotions.
